Y8 block,A6 pistons,BONE STOCK Y8 head and cam, Y8 intake manifold w/H22 throttle body(matched in plenum entrance, no porting in runners),generic cold air pipe, Dc 4-1 header,adjustable cam gear, and Hondata S200.
This is a very mild engine we put together for the purpose of testing off-the-shelf aftermarket cams in a combination we felt was representative of the average setup. To be fair, we had to give the Y8 cam a fair chance first.
